i´ve a VPLEX Metro cluster. Under both clusters are VNX5200. Now, after implementing VPLEX and provision first storage via VPLEX i´ve seen, that the storage on VNX is misconfigured. On each cluster there are running the ESX-Hosts. I´ve to rebuild the storagepool on both VNX. Is there an documentation that describe the way to do so? Maybe without destroy the hole VPLEX-Implementation? Or can someone describe what i have to do to get the storage configuration reconfigured... I gues, the biggest problem would be the meta-volumes?!

My thoughts:

If you are rebuilding on the VNX with existing space (physical drives, new pool, etc) then you should be able to leverage virtual LUN migrations on the VNX to the exposed storage volumes and I believe that is supported. If you physically have to destroy the existing pools on the VNX's, then your other alternative might be to split DR1 volumes, fix that VNX, re-present and re-sync the DR1 volume, and then do the other side once it is completely synchronized. If they are using only local volumes and you have to rebuild the VNX, then you can use the opposite approach in terms of creating a DR1 volume across the wire to maintain host access (at a performance penalty perhaps is accessed remotely), fix your VNX, re-mirror, and then break the DR1 and present locally to get back to the starting point.

For the meta-volumes and logging volumes, there are CLI commands that can be used to move/migrate those to new devices as needed as well. I believe some of those procedures are in the SolVe desktop as well.
